    How to Make a Fortune Teller Step by Step

    This method focuses on breaking the process into manageable actions that anyone can follow.

    Folding Process in Detail

    • Fold the square paper diagonally both ways
    • Open and fold each corner toward the center
    • Flip the paper and repeat corner folds
    • Fold the paper in half horizontally and vertically
    • Insert fingers into the four pockets
    • Test movement and adjust folds

    FAQs:

    What paper works best for fortune tellers?

    Standard printer or origami paper works best.

    Can fortune tellers be reused?

    Yes, as long as the paper stays intact.

    Are fortune tellers suitable for classrooms?

    Absolutely, they are widely used in education.

    How long does it take to make one?

    Usually 3–5 minutes with practice.
